The quality of this initial capture is paramount; a high-fidelity microphone and preamp will preserve the nuance, dynamic range, and character of the original sound source, ensuring that the digital representation is as accurate as possible. Microphones, the primary input devices, convert acoustic energy—vocal cords vibrating or a guitar string resonating—into a corresponding voltage.
